1. A fluid injection apparatus for use with a syringe, comprising:

  • an injector comprising a housing defining an opening for a drive piston extendable from the injector housing for imparting motive forces to a syringe plunger disposed within the syringe;

    a pressure jacket associated with the injector for securing the syringe during an injection procedure, the pressure jacket having a distal end defining a syringe receiving opening for receiving the syringe and a proximal end associated with the injector housing and generally aligned with the opening; and

    a syringe sensor adapted to be engaged by the syringe when the syringe is loaded into the pressure jacket, the syringe sensor adapted to generate a signal indicating the presence of the syringe in the pressure jacket.
